I pushed an initial implementation of IGNITE-3477 to ignite-3477 branch for
community review and further discussion.

Note that the implementation lacks the following features:
 - On-heap deserialized values cache
 - Full LOCAL cache support
 - Eviction policies
 - Multiple memory pools
 - Distributed joins support
 - Off-heap circular remove buffer
 - Maybe something else I missed

The subject of this discussion is to determine whether the PageMemory
approach is a way to go, because the this implementation is almost 2x
slower than current 2.0 branch. There is some room for improvement, but I
am not completely sure we can gain the same performance numbers as in 2.0.

I encourage the community to review the code and architecture and share
their thoughts here.
